  • From the Vault The Long Lost System Shock 2 Sketchbook

    It is common for studios of Irrationals longevity to lose or misplace assets, due to hardware failures, moves across town, and the inevitable ravages of entropy. Finding these assets years later is like stumbling upon buried treasure on an island you discovered by accident. Irrational Games just dug up a particularly precious artifact: a sketchbook from System Shock 2. Were talking original artwork on honest-to-goodness paper no Wacom tablets or Cintiq monitors, but paper with the original coffee stains still ...

  • Levine on System Shock 3: "Would I turn my nose up at another round with Shodan? No"

    2K Boston's Ken Levine has told VG247 that he loves the world of System Shock and would be interested in a third game in the EA-owned series if the opportunity arose.

  • System Shock 2 2K7

    Gnome's Lair has just posted a collection of mods and fixes, that will help you majorly upgrade System Shock 2 and run it under Windows XP. Enhancements include new textures, better sound, new 3d models and bug fixes.
